Ould Cheikh, Yemeni parties discuss security matters in Muscat

MUSCAT, Sept 6 (KUNA) -- UN Special envoy to Yemen Ismail Ould Cheikh Ahmad met with representatives of clashing Yemeni parties in Muscat late Monday, to discuss an agreement on ending the war in Yemen.
The meeting with officials from Ansarullah movement and General People's Congress discussed several topics, previously presented in the Jeddah meeting on security issues in the country, Ould Cheikh said in a press statement.
The envoy hoped resolution 2015 and the GCC initiative would end conflict in the war-torn country.
He added that the UN strongly supports lifting air ban on Sanaa's International Airport and allow Yemeni citizens to move freely.(end) ahr.ag
